Anti-alpha 1 Fetoprotein antibody [EPR20365-101] - BSA and Azide free (Capture), Abcam, AB252573
ab252573 is a BSA and Azide Free antibody supplied in an unconjugated format and it is suitable for sandwich ELISAs to quantify Human alpha Fetoprotein. The recommended pair for sandwich ELISA is: Capture: ab252573, Human alpha Fetoprotein Capture Antibody (unconjugated) Detector: ab252632 , Human alpha Fetoprotein Detector Antibody (unconjugated) The reference range value is 156 - 10000 pg/ml. Phospho-Threonine-Proline Mouse Monoclonal Antibody (P-Thr-Pro-101)#9391, Cell Signaling Technology (CST), 9391
Phospho-Threonine-Proline Mouse Monoclonal Antibody (P-Thr-Pro-101) detects phospho-threonine only when followed by proline. This antibody reacts with proteins and peptides phosphorylated at the Thr-Pro motif in an otherwise highly context-independent fashion. This antibody is phospho-specific, but does not recognize phospho-threonine in the absence of an adjacent proline. This antibody does not react with phospho-tyrosine but does react with some phospho-serine peptides containing the phospho-serine-proline motif (e.g., phospho-Elk-1).
